Prescription Information Modernization Act of 2025
HR 4132, the Prescription Information Modernization Act of 2025, allows drug manufacturers to provide FDA-approved prescribing information for prescription drugs exclusively through electronic means, while requiring them to offer paper copies at no additional cost upon request by prescribers or dispensers. The bill directly affects drug manufacturers, doctors, pharmacists, and other healthcare professionals who rely on prescribing information. Key provisions include mandating that manufacturers give prescribers/dispensers the choice to continue receiving paper copies or request them as needed, and requiring the HHS Secretary to issue implementing regulations within one year to support this transition. The law takes effect two years after enactment or when final regulations are issued, whichever comes first.
